Rebels Ready for NCAA Qualifier
2/20/2015 | Rifle
OXFORD, Miss. - With winter weather wreaking havoc across the country, including the South, the Ole Miss rifle team will travel to Jacksonville Ala., for a second straight weekend, to compete in the NCAA Qualifier. The Rebels were originally scheduled to compete at the NCAA Qualifier in Lexington, Kentucky.
This weekend's score posted at the qualifier will represent 50 percent of the score considered for teams that qualify for NCAAs. The score at the qualifier will be averaged with their three highest scores of the year to determine who is selected to the NCAA Championships. Only the top eight overall scores will advance to the NCAA Championships. The Rebels have had an individual representative in the NCAAs three straight years.
"This team knows that this is crunch time and the only opportunity for some to see postseason play," head coach Valerie Boothe said. "They are as ready as they can be. Now it's all on each to finish what they started."
Sophomore Alison Weisz and freshman Jessica Haig have led the Rebels this season and present the best chance to qualify for the NCAAs as individuals. Weisz leads in smallbore with an average of 572, while both she and Haig are averaging 585 in air rifle. Last weekend, Haig shot a career-best 591 in air rifle against Navy and then followed up with a PR (573) in smallbore at Jacksonville State.
